The Local Government Transparency Code

This code requires all local councils to publish their account information, showing revenue collected from on-street parking, off-street parking and penalty charge notices and associated expenditure.

The council has no jurisdiction in respect of on-street parking. Details of this are available from cars and parking (leicestershire.gov.uk)

The following is the information relating to our off-street car parks.

When there is a surplus, under Section 55 of the Road Traffic Regulation Act (1984) there are a number of areas which the car parking account can fund. These areas include, but are not limited to: 

  • Transport, highway or road improvements 
  • Environmental improvements (including reduction of pollution and improvement or maintenance of amenity)
  • Provision of outdoor recreational facilities available to the public without charge
